当前位置:首页 > 编程技术 > 正文

js如何添加原有数组的值

js如何添加原有数组的值

在JavaScript中,你可以通过几种不同的方式向一个数组中添加值。以下是一些常见的方法:1. 使用 `push( ` 方法向数组的末尾添加一个或多个元素,并返回新的...

在JavaScript中,你可以通过几种不同的方式向一个数组中添加值。以下是一些常见的方法:

1. 使用 `push()` 方法向数组的末尾添加一个或多个元素,并返回新的长度。

2. 使用 `unshift()` 方法向数组的开头添加一个或多个元素,并返回新的长度。

3. 使用扩展运算符(...)结合 `push()` 方法来添加多个元素。

4. 使用 `splice()` 方法来添加或删除数组中的元素。

以下是一些示例代码:

```javascript

// 使用 push() 方法添加单个元素

let array = [1, 2, 3];

array.push(4); // array 现在是 [1, 2, 3, 4]

// 使用 push() 方法添加多个元素

array.push(5, 6, 7); // array 现在是 [1, 2, 3, 4, 5, 6, 7]

// 使用 unshift() 方法添加单个元素到数组开头

array.unshift(0); // array 现在是 [0, 1, 2, 3, 4, 5, 6, 7]

// 使用 unshift() 方法添加多个元素到数组开头

array.unshift(-1, -2); // array 现在是 [-1, -2, 0, 1, 2, 3, 4, 5, 6, 7]

// 使用扩展运算符和 push() 方法添加多个元素

array = [...array, 8, 9]; // array 现在是 [-1, -2, 0, 1, 2, 3, 4, 5, 6, 7, 8, 9]

// 使用 splice() 方法添加元素到指定位置

array.splice(2, 0, 'a', 'b'); // array 现在是 [-1, -2, 'a', 'b', 0, 1, 2, 3, 4, 5, 6, 7, 8, 9]

```

根据你的具体需求,你可以选择最适合的方法来向数组中添加值。

最新文章